Output 21f38193bd4ca5f0f99e5d71f3c4a857404221cbc808baeedb98a2a466db343b:0
- value
- 1029072
- script pubkey
- OP_0 OP_PUSHBYTES_20 18b8a4e23869b56da0581ed712b7470fb8035256
- address
- bc1qrzu2fc3cdx6kmgzcrmt39d68p7uqx5jkp4rjwt
- transaction
- 21f38193bd4ca5f0f99e5d71f3c4a857404221cbc808baeedb98a2a466db343b
- confirmations
- 44015
- spent
- true